Changes to political system by next month

LEGISLATION was introduced in Parliament yesterday to make a number of major changes to the political system. If all goes according to plan, the revisions should become law by next month.

The legislative move comes some 10 months after Prime Minister Lee Hsien Loong announced his plan to provide for more diverse views in Parliament.

The changes pave the way for greater opposition representation in Parliament, via an increase in the allowable number of Non-Constituency Members of Parliament (NCMPs) and the entrenchment of the Nominated MP (NMP) scheme.
